New paper! We characterized the breeding system elements (number of breeders, relatedness, reproductive skew) of fire ant using data from a long-term rearing study combined with data from previous studies. Open access at: onlinelibrary.wiley.com/doi/full/10....
A Comprehensive Account of the Breeding Systems of the Fire Ant Solenopsis invicta
We comprehensively characterized the breeding system of polygyne fire ant colonies by tracking parentage, relatedness, and supergene genotypes in a large-scale, longitudinal experiment. Our results r....
